ImageVerifierCode 换一换
格式:DOCX , 页数:13 ,大小:155.02KB ,
资源ID:21110363      下载积分:3 金币
快捷下载
登录下载
邮箱/手机:
温馨提示:
快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。 如填写123,账号就是123,密码也是123。
特别说明:
请自助下载,系统不会自动发送文件的哦; 如果您已付费,想二次下载,请登录后访问:我的下载记录
支付方式: 支付宝    微信支付   
验证码:   换一换

加入VIP,免费下载
 

温馨提示:由于个人手机设置不同,如果发现不能下载,请复制以下地址【https://www.bdocx.com/down/21110363.html】到电脑端继续下载(重复下载不扣费)。

已注册用户请登录:
账号:
密码:
验证码:   换一换
  忘记密码?
三方登录: 微信登录   QQ登录  

下载须知

1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。
2: 试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
3: 文件的所有权益归上传用户所有。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 本站仅提供交流平台,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

版权提示 | 免责声明

本文(基于ARM的电子点菜系统Word格式文档下载.docx)为本站会员(b****6)主动上传,冰豆网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知冰豆网(发送邮件至service@bdocx.com或直接QQ联系客服),我们立即给予删除!

基于ARM的电子点菜系统Word格式文档下载.docx

1、1.2 项目主要功能 32 项目需求规格 33 系统设计描述 44 系统功能测试 45 项目及课程总结 46 参考资料 51 项目概述1.1 项目名称 名称:1.2 项目主要功能系统实现了如下主要功能:(1) 是一个能够为客户查看菜单,点菜,删菜提供高度支持的系统;(2) 包括记录菜单信息的能力,能够进行订单跟踪;(3) 保留合适的数据库和历史信息,支持市场分析;(4) 为客户查询提供客户交易历史记录;(5) 保留历史记录,支持销售分析和预测市场需求。2 项目需求规格 该系统主要有两个使用者,一个是用户,一个是管理员,下图是系统的用例图:功能点: 客户浏览菜单中菜的信息,这些信息要能全面的显示

2、各个菜的价格以及口味,特色等 客户选中自己喜欢的菜放入已选菜单 客户删除已选菜单中不想要的菜 系统计算消费额并显示给客户 客户浏览自己已选中的菜,并最终确认点菜 系统收到确认点菜的信息后,就将已点好的菜单保存 客户提出特殊的要求,如忌口等,系统记录这些信息并保存进数据库 系统将保存好的菜单在超级终端显示出来,以供厨房使用 系统在超级终端提示客户的特殊要求,以提醒厨房 管理员往菜谱中添加新菜的信息 管理员修改菜谱中已有菜的信息 管理员删除菜谱中无效的菜的信息 客户搜索指定菜的信息 点菜成功后,超级终端打印客户消费的账目明细 客户对本次消费过程进行评价,系统保存客户的评价3 系统设计描述给出系统的

3、解决方案,并证明该方案可以满足需求规格的要求根据需求规格的要求,给出以下系统的解决方案:电子点菜系统共分成客户端、数据库、服务器端三个子系统,其功能模块结构如图所示:用户在客户端操作的流程图,如下所示:数据流图:顶层数据流图:一层数据流图:根据项目需求规格中的定义,设计出描述了系统中所要进行的几个主要活动及它们之间约束关系的活动图:4 系统功能测试结合需求规格来指明测试环境如何配置,并与需求规格中的具体功能点描述一一对应来写测试用例结合需求规格配置如下测试环境:A、系统的硬件:ARM的2410S开发板PC、机B、操作系统:UC/OS 2的嵌入式操作系统C、开发软件:在QTOPIA上开发用户界面

4、,先将电子点菜谱在主机上搭建软件平台并在软件 上去实现它的功能,使用数据库查询和链接技术,菜单通过2410S开发板的LCD 显示,分级菜单模式。结合需求规格中的功能点描述编写以下功能测试用例:用例编号001功能A描述客户浏览菜单中菜的信息,这些信息要能全面的显示各个菜的价格以及口味,特色等用例目的测试该功能是否实现前提条件在电子点菜系统下,一切软件硬件环境就绪的条件下子用例编号输入/动作期望的输出/相应实际情况状态0011选中一个菜名 显示该菜相应的信息 显示正确 成功002客户选中自己喜欢的菜放入已选菜单在电子点菜系统下,一切软件硬件环境就绪的条件下,客户发现自己喜欢的菜,想存入已选菜单00

5、21选中一个菜 相应的菜被存入已选菜单 存储成功003客户删除已选菜单中不想要的菜在电子点菜系统下,一切软件硬件环境就绪的条件下,客户发现自己已选的菜中,有不想要的菜0031删除一个已选中的菜 相应的菜被从已选菜单中删除 删除成功004系统计算消费额并显示给客户在电子点菜系统下,一切软件硬件环境就绪的条件下,客户提交菜单后0041客户提交菜单 显示消费额 消费额显示正确005客户浏览自己已选中的菜,并最终确认点菜在电子点菜系统下,一切软件硬件环境就绪的条件下,客户选好菜后0051客户点确认提交菜单 菜单成功提交 菜单提交成功006系统收到确认点菜的信息后,就将已点好的菜单保存在电子点菜系统下,

6、一切软件硬件环境就绪的条件下,客户已提交菜单0061 菜单成功保存入数据库 菜单保存成功007客户提出特殊的要求,如忌口等,系统记录这些信息并保存进数据库0071客户提出特殊要求 特殊要求保存入数据库 特殊要求保存成功008系统将保存好的菜单在超级终端显示出来,以供厨房使用0081 超级终端显示菜单009系统在超级终端提示客户的特殊要求,以提醒厨房在电子点菜系统下,一切软件硬件环境就绪的条件下,客户提出特殊要求,并且特殊要求已存入数据库0091超级终端显示客户的特殊要求 超级终端显示特殊要求0010管理员往菜谱中添加新菜的信息在电子点菜系统下,一切软件硬件环境就绪的条件下,餐厅有了新的菜色,需

7、要加入菜谱0101 新菜添加成功 新菜添加成功并能显示管理员修改菜谱中已有菜的信息在电子点菜系统下,一切软件硬件环境就绪的条件下,餐厅需要修改菜谱中菜的信息0111管理员修改菜谱中菜的信息 菜的信息修改成功 菜修改成功并能显示0012管理员删除菜谱中无效的菜的信息0121管理员删除菜谱中无效菜的信息 无效的菜删除成功无效的菜删除成功0013客户搜索指定菜的信息在电子点菜系统下,一切软件硬件环境就绪的条件下,客户有需要的菜搜索0131输入一个菜名 显示该菜的信息搜索的菜的信息显示成功0014点菜成功后,超级终端打印客户消费的账目明细0141 打印出客户消费的账目明细客户消费的账目明细打印成功00

8、15客户对本次消费过程进行评价,系统保存客户的评价在电子点菜系统下,一切软件硬件环境就绪的条件下,客户有已提交菜单0151客户在系统中输入对本次消费过程的评价显示评价已收到,对客户表示感谢评价已收到,对客户表示感谢5 项目及课程总结在本次项目中,我们实现了电子点菜系统的基本框架,但是由于受到硬件条件的限制,在数据库容量方面没有达到需求规格中的要求,但是我们还是通过这次项目学到了很多知识,尤其是在软件工程的文档搭建方面收获很大,使我们从以前单纯的进行代码编写的学生式的开发模式转变成从设计到开发到测试的系统的工程开发。这对我们今后的学习工作都有积极的促进作用。本课程实验训练的步骤为:Set up

9、WorkSpace-Project Planning -Requirement Analysis-System Design-Test Plan and Test Report -课程实验报告。这个步骤正是软件工程项目开发的步骤,因此,我们在完成课程实验的同时,体验了软件工程这门理论课程在实际应用中的作用,达到了在实践中获得经验教训的效果。通过一个学期的学习,这门课给我留下了深刻的印象,使我更进一步理解了软件工程这门学科的意义,同时也使我了解到它在软件行业的重要作用,最重要的,是我掌握了设计阶段和测试阶段的一些必要的技术,相信在今后的工作中一定会有广泛的应用。最后,我想对本门课程提出一个小小的

10、建议:在实验的过程中,虽然老师对所有的学生进行了分组,但由于并没有小组合作完成的任务,所以导致了小组成员之间的交流有限,通过对软件工程这门课程的学习,我了解到软件开发过程中分工合作是很重要的,一个项目组的组织架构是否合理决定了一个项目的进度快慢甚至是成败,所以,我建议在今后开展这门课的时候要多布置一些小组合作完成的任务,这样不仅可以使我们在学习过程中模拟具体实践中的组织架构以及分工,还能使我们锻炼出良好的团队精神,相信这一定是一个一举多得的好方法。6 参考资料 【1】数据库技术与Access应用教程 刘瑞新,程志云等编著, 机械工业出版社 2009.09 【2】嵌入式实时操作系统ucosII第二版 邵贝贝翻译 ,北京航空航天出版社 2007-9-1【3】ARM9嵌入式系统设计基于S3C2410与Linux, 徐英慧等著, 北京航空航天大学出版社,2007年9月第一版【4】深入理解Linux内核(第三版),(美)博伟等著,中国电力出版社,2007-9 Qtopia编程之道, 苗忠良, 清华大学出版社,2009-1

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1